Berkeley Law Foundation Holds Its Sixth Annual Auction
On Friday, November 16, the Berkeley Law Foundation (BLF) hosted its Sixth Annual Auction. The event began at 8 p.m. in the Pauley Ballroom of the Martin Luther King Jr. Building on Sproul Plaza.

The auction raises money for the Phoenix Fellowship, which was established in 1997 to encourage students of color to attend the School of Law as well as to support public interest work among these students.

This year's auction featured an incredible assortment of items donated by Boalt faculty, alumni, students, staff and corporate sponsors. Event attendees bid on everything from baseball tickets to dance lessons to the chance to play a living chess game where law school faculty members serve as the pieces.
